Introduction
KillerBOWL XIII. I played a huge DS9-Earth deck with Jaresh-Inyo, O'Brien + No Wins.

Round 1Constance CorbettMW (+10)
I gave my daughter Cardassian speed again to play. Constance is a mercenary. I have to pay her to play Trek with her Dad. But this time she had to work for it, getting $5 for every game she solved two missions in. I got hit with a WNOHGB early and it slowed me down. Constance solved two missions and I had one solved during my turn when time was called (she went first). So I went for my 2nd mission. Constance played Captain's Holiday straight up and I didn't have the requirements. I played Bridge Officer's Test. Everyone was trying to tell her to use Mila to cancel it, without telling her outright. I even said loudly, 'I'm playing a interrupt'. But she didn't remember her ability and I solved. We would've been tied, but I got bonus points from Enterprise-A on both my missions for a mod win.

Round 2TNGBen HospFL (-90)
BenHosp played the terrible two-mission win Cadet deck with the new Enterprise-D and the "A". This deck is silly and Restore Errant Moon needs errata. I didn't get A Few Minor Difficulties out to help stop the bonus point nonsense, so it was a 100-10 beatdown.

Round 3Darrell MinottFW (+30)
Darrell rocked Starfleet non-humans. I couldn't get Holding Cell out to snag Nathan Samuel so Darrell 'barfed' out all sorts of non-humans on me. Darrell was cruising, but I used Shran's Ship (i forget the name) to make it 13 range to solve two missions for a true trademark Corbett "For the Win" comeback.

Round 4Neil TimmonsFW (+5)
Neil was rocking Klingon/Tragic Turn. But now it's ok since TT isn't stupid broken. I went planet first and my guys got wipped out. To avoid getting smoked by the same dilemmas (manheims) I went to space next before solving the planet. Luckily, the space mission I pack is Mediate Peace Treaty, so no dirty Krudge action for him. Neil solved all three missions, but I dusted off the old school classic dilemma Damaged Reputation and hit it with him twice (once using manheim), so he was stuck at 95 points. Sucks when Kang make all your Klingons +2 integrity.... anyways, Sloan showed up and blew up all of Neil's manheims and his dilemmas pile was empty (this thing consumed like a champ). So I was able to solved my last mission clean without having to face any dilemmas.
